So, if line 1 is does not equal line 451 or line 181 does not equal line 631, then the file is not valid. Those two points are at line 1 and line 181 for the horizontal pattern, and lines 451 and 631 for the vertical pattern. So, the horizontal curves and the vertical curves would intersect at two points: to the North and to the South, both at elevation angle zero. The vertical plane would start at the Zenith over your head and move down to the North, then under your feet, South, and back to the Zenith. In that case, the horizontal plane would have all values at elevation angle zero and would start at azimuth zero, moving toward East, South, West, and back to North. In system, if the antenna azimuth is zero and the antenna elevation angle is zero, the antenna will point to the North. The values for the horizontal plane and vertical plane generate two curves that intersect at two places. If the antenna pattern is complex, there is a chance that the interpolation can give erratic results when the beam is pointing away from the recorded values. If the link direction is outside those planes, the program will interpolate a value. In the file, each plane has 360 values, the horizontal first, followed by the vertical. The antenna file only contains values in the horizontal plane and vertical plane. If the radio beam of a path does not correspond to the direction where the antenna is pointing, the program will use the values in the antenna file to calculate the correction needed. The values in antenna file are used to modify that value. The antenna gain entered in the Coverage is the maximum gain of the antenna. The antenna gain is defined in your Coverage parameters, not in the antenna file. Radio Mobile Compatible antenna files (XXXXXX.ant) are text files.Įach line is a relative gain in dB, and are normally zero or negative values.Ī complete antenna file should contain 720 rows.
